From emergency care to lasting recovery
Patients from Hybla Valley often ask where to go after an ER visit or when their primary care physician recommends conservative care first. Inova Fairfax Medical Campus (Level I Trauma, Falls Church), Inova Fair Oaks Hospital, and Virginia Hospital Center serve the region surrounding Hybla Valley. Emergency departments excel at ruling out fractures and acute emergencies — but they are not designed to manage the weeks of soft-tissue rehabilitation that follow. That gap is where Whiplash Treatment at Roselle Center becomes essential. We request imaging and records from your existing providers, build a coordinated plan, and focus on restoring function so Hybla Valley residents return to work, sport, and family life without long-term medication dependence.
